The real lunacy has begun and the Rev. Jerry Falwell has issued as to who the real people to blame for this tradegy on Tuesday. As reported in the New York Times .."The Rev. Jerry Falwell said Thursday that the ACLU, with abortion providers, gay rights proponents and federal courts that had banned school prayer and legalized abortion, had SO WEAKENED THE UNITED STATES spiritually that the nation was left exposed to Tuesday's terrorist attacks." Falwell further commented that he did not believe God "had anything to do with the tradegy," but that God had permitted it. "He lifted the curtain of protection," Falwell said, "and I believe that if America does not repent and return to a genuine faith and dependence on him, we may expect more tradegies, unfortunately." " God has protected America from her inception," Falwell said. "It is only recently that many decided God is unnecessary."

And we think the fanatical Muslims are scary(and they are), when we have have the same here in this country.
